Archester Newsome Obituary

The Homegoing Graveside service for Mr. Archester “Chester” Newsome, Sr. who passed away on Monday, July 6, 2020, will be held on Saturday July 25th, at 2 p.m. at Garden of Memories Cemetery, 4207 E. Lake Avenue, with Archbishop David A. Jones, Sr., Pastor of Mountain Top International Ministries, Inc. officiating.  Interment will follow.  Please follow the CDC guidelines. Masks are required.  

 Archester Newsome was born in Quitman, Georgia to his parents, Norris and Minnie Lee (Jones) Newsome. He was a graduate of Union Academy High School, Bartow, FL. Mr. Newsome retired after many years of dedicated service from Florida Steel.  After his retirement, he operated his own business at the Funland Flea Market.  “Chester”, affectionately called by most family members, and “Archie” by others, loved the Lord.

He was a member of Mt. Zion M.B. Church where he sang with the choir. He later joined Mount Olive M.B. Church and was a faithful member until he took ill. 

He was preceded in death by: his parents and sons, Greggory Wallace and Joseph Wallace. 

Archie leaves to mourn and cherish his memories: his devoted and loving wife, Carol Newsome; two sons, A. Stephen (Monique) Newsome of Virginia, and Olyn Reecha Newsome; two daughters, Shasta Yolanda Newsome and Charlotte Cecelia Wallace of Tampa, FL; brother, Eugene Newsome of Sanford, FL; three sisters, Annie Ruth Newsome, Margaret Newsome Dowdell and Betty Newsome of Rochester, NY; aunt Bessie (Lewis) Manning; uncle, James (Mary) Lewis of Valdosta GA; fifteen grandchildren; twenty-one great grandchildren; two great-great grandchildren; a host of nieces, nephews, cousins, in-laws, dear friends, his Flea Market Buddies, Colleagues and many health care professionals who cared for him during his illness. He has left a big void in our hearts. 

The visitation will be held from 3 - 7 p.m. on Friday, July 24th, at Ray Williams Funeral Home, 301 North Howard Ave.  We are asking family and friends to follow the CDC guidelines. Masks are required.  On Saturday, July 25th the family will line up at the Newsome residence at 1 p.m., then proceed to Garden of Memories Cemetery.
